Dean Kramer writes a monthly column for MSWorld, Inc. called Life on Cripple Creek, and has been widely published as an essayist. She has received journalistic recognition for her sensitive essays on the plight of Haitian farm workers in Pennsylvania, has written lyrics for an Off-Broadway musical on the life of Will Rogers, written articles about the training of dogs who assist the disabled, and has written for both commercial and documentary film. Her work on the documentary film """"Me"""" earned her a Golden Eagle award from the American Cine Society. Life on Cripple Creek is her first collection of essays.
